Job Summary

  • Exempt: No
  • Performs and is responsible for the day to day professional activities of the Pharmacy Department including duties involving compounding, admixing sterile products, drug consultations, dispensing, providing drug information, and monitoring patient drug therapy.         Job Roles

        Pharmacist (AHCL)

        • Conducts and accurately documents in the medical record drug protocols as ordered by physicians including, but not limited to, TPN, Pharmacokinetic, and Heparin. Contacts and intervenes with physicians and/or nurses regarding questions, errors, or irregularities on orders.
        • Maintains and meets expectations on time for all competencies, license, certifications and education requirements as outlined by local administration, Adventist Health (AH), The Joint Commission (TJC),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S), and all other regulatory agencies.
        • Maintains computerized patient record system to monitor medication therapy for safety and efficacy, including but not limited to, medications, med errors, and nursing unit inspections.
        • Maintains daily records of controlled drugs as required by law.
        • Monitors and intervenes on all drug regimens as indicated by quality assurance plan, including, but not limited to, drug-drug interactions, drug allergies, toxic/therapeutic drug levels, and appropriateness indications.
        • Provides clinical drug information to meet the needs of the physicians and nursing staff through direct contact and/or committee participation.
        • Reviews inventory levels to ensure that all outdated drugs, or drugs that have lost their potency, are removed.
        • Supervises support personnel in routine performance of their duties, including but not limited to, IV admixtures, medication dispensation and medication compounding. Willingly performs other duties and innovations as assigned.
